Contact Tracing Highlights
  1. Cluster 259115: Contact tracing of a 15-year-old male citizen who testing positive through random community screening revealed 8 family-related cases living in the same household.  The cases detected include the index case’s parents and siblings, four of whom are under the age of ten.
  2. Cluster 256900: A 26-year-old symptomatic male citizen was linked to 6 positive cases from the same household.  The cases detected are family related and include the index case’s parents, brother, sister-in-law and nephews.
  3. Cluster 262297: Contact tracing of a symptomatic 48-year-old male citizen revealed 7 positive cases from 2 different households.  The cases detected are family related and include the index case’s father, wife and children.
  4. Cluster 259893: Contact tracing of a symptomatic 22-year-old male expatriate revealed 6 family-related positive cases all living in one household.  The cases detected had direct contact with the index case and include his father and siblings. 
  5. Cluster 258370: A symptomatic 69-year-old female citizen was linked to 5 positive cases from a single household.  The cases detected are family related and include the index case’s nephew, his wife and children.
